Ross Still Press.jpegDOP Ross Giardina was nominated for Best Cinematography at the Camerimage Cinematography Festival Poland for the short film, Legend.

The 20 minute film was directed by Stephen De Villiers and written by Judy Morris. It was shot in 2009 on the RED camera over five days in several Sydney locations.

Legend tells the tale of Harley and his younger brother Cliff, andtheir attempts to escape their abusive father. When Harley steps in toprotect his brother, both boys end up in hospital with direconsequences.

It was one of the four films to form the featurelength AFTRS/NIDA co-production, Before the Rain and was then releasedas a stand alone short.

“Legend allowed me to create a look forthe film that was instilled by the characters and their journey,” saysGiardina. “Camerimage is the holy grail for cinematographers and I hadno idea about this until going to the event. With names such as DionBeebe, Wally Psifer, Vittorio Storraro and Matt Libatique to name a fewin attendance, I was incredibly humbled to be nominated in the shortscategory.”
